Weekly Update

We have had a busy yet exciting first week of school here in RM 21! Students have continued to participate in activities to get to know their classmates and 4th grade peers. On Wednesday students worked together in teams to Save Sam the gummy worm and the Paper Chain Challenge! (see pictures below). We focused on making sure each team member has a job and positive talk, even when the tasks becomes hard.












Exploring books from our library. 



This week we read several picture books that taught us to persevere. We brainstormed this we can't do and wrote them on a t-shirt. We are officially retiring these statements.

First Day!

Good afternoon families! We had a great day getting to know one another and just some of the in's and out's for fourth grade, including deciphering the two Mrs. Williams'. We began our day with Morning Meeting in which students played a choice movement activity. Ask your child about some of the choices they had to make (ex: book vs movie). Children also had the chance to express how they felt about 4th grade. Many students feel nervous coming into 4th grade. We read several books today that helped us cope with these feelings. Students participated in other fun activities to get to know each other. In "Find someone who...." we discovered that many of the students in our class have green eyes! Students also worked together to discover the different areas of our classroom by participating in a classroom scavenger hunt.





Scavenger hunt 






Your child also learned how to use their homework folder and assignment notebook to stay organized and complete homework. Your child's first homework assignment is the Brown Bag Mystery and is due Thursday August 30th.
